Hilton Head’s coastal location makes it susceptible to severe weather events, leading to significant water intrusion. Strong winds and heavy rains can cause harm to your roof, causing rainwater to drain directly into your home or company. Worse, severe weather can sometimes result in flash flooding, particularly if your property is located in a flood-prone zone.

You would be surprised to know that at times, people living in multiple story units, forget to turn the water off as they are preparing a bath and it overflows, other times washing machines fail, overflowing. These events cause flooding on the floors where these units are installed and at times they end up leaking from upstairs to the units below. These events end up flooding inside the walls, floors, and damaging drywall and ceiling as well as other home components. The pipes on your property carry water throughout, so a leak or puncture can lead to significant damage. A leaking kitchen sink pipe might allow enough water to flow into the cabinet below it, potentially causing damage. A leaking pipe inside the walls may make things worse. A leak like this can cause significant water damage and the formation of a mold colony because the entire wall is wetted. Worse yet, if there is a leak in your plumbing supply line or drainage pipe in the soil beneath your concrete slab, you’ll be out of luck. Hair, grease accumulation, toiletries, dirt, and other foreign objects can obstruct the drainpipe and prevent regular drainage. When clogged drains are not addressed promptly, they may easily back up and cause flooding and damage to your home’s interior. An inefficient, obstructed, damaged, or failing sump pump will leave your basement dealing with large quantities of water that cannot be drained. Many people wouldn’t think of it, but a common side-effect of fire is dealing with heavy water damage. First Responders and emergency sprinkler systems douse the entirety of the property under considerable amounts of water in an effort to stop the fire. We also have had many events where people looking for a place to hang their clothes, use the pipes for the sprinkler system, which triggers the sprinklers, flooding many floors at times. The physical integrity of your roof is vital to maintaining conditions on the inside of your home. Over time, natural wear and tear will cause roofs to weaken and leaks to form. When the roof is breached, precipitation will enter your home and begin to cause damage in its wake. If the water damage is not addressed within 24-48 hours after the intrusion, the standing water and buildup of humidity may lead to mold growth.
